WebOct 1, 2015 · RESULTS: Optic nerve sheath fenestration analysis included 712 patients. Postprocedure, there was improvement of vision in 59%, headache in 44%, and papilledema in 80%; 14.8% of patients required a repeat procedure with major and minor complication rates of 1.5% and 16.4%, respectively. Webconsidering surgery for PTC, options include optic nerve sheath fenestration, VP shunting, or venous sinus stenting. The overall rate of visual improvement seems to be equivalent across surgical interventions, and there is insufficient evidence to recommend or reject any one surgical intervention over another at this time. 5,6
